The song "Birthday" by Tlot Tlot touches upon themes of identity, war, sacrifice, and the artist's role in society. The lyrics depict a sense of displacement and frustration experienced by the singer. The line "I left the water boiling, and my blood was boiling" suggests a feeling of urgency or restlessness, perhaps symbolizing the singer's desire for change or escape from a constrictive environment.

The lyrics also reference the singer being an "Asian painter" who is willing to paint objects such as barns, gates, and fences. This could be interpreted as the singer embracing their artistic abilities and being willing to take on any job or project, regardless of its artistic value, in order to survive.

The mention of fighting in a war and dying for a cause speaks to the theme of sacrifice and the human cost of conflict. The line "I bought some fish, but had to pay for a hundred dollars, for a fishtank" could be seen as a commentary on the cost of living and the burden of financial struggles.

The song takes a darker turn towards the end with the mention of biting a baby on a mother's breast, banter on Christmas, and capturing the priest. These lines could symbolize a rebellion against societal norms, challenging established structures, and questioning religious beliefs.

Overall, the lyrics of "Birthday" convey a sense of frustration, alienation, and a longing for freedom. The song prompts listeners to reflect on the complexities of identity, the sacrifices made in life, and the artist's role in society.
